Yenagoa City International 10KM Race to Chip Every Runner for Accurate Timing

As preparations intensify for the highly anticipated Yenagoa City International 10KM Race 2026, organizers, Nilayo Sports Management Ltd have announced a major technological boost aimed at enhancing race integrity and participant experience, every registered runner will be equipped with a timing chip.

The introduction of chip timing ensures precise tracking of each runner’s performance from start to finish, aligning the race with international best practices and standards. 

This innovation guarantees accurate results, eliminates discrepancies, and enhances transparency across all categories of participants.

According to the organizers, the decision underscores a strong commitment to delivering a world-class race experience in Yenagoa, while positioning the event as one of the premier road races in Nigeria and beyond.

“Every runner counts, and with the introduction of chip timing, we are ensuring that each participant’s effort is properly recorded and recognized. This is about fairness, precision, and elevating the overall race experience,” the organizers stated.

In addition to the chip timing system, all runners who successfully complete the race will receive a finisher’s medal, celebrating their achievement and participation in what promises to be a historic sporting event.

The race, scheduled for April 4, will attract elite and amateur runners from across the globe, will not only promote fitness and wellness but also showcase the cultural and tourism appeal of Bayelsa State.

Registration remains open at the Samson Siasia Stadium, Ministry of Sports and online, with interested participants encouraged to secure their slots and be part of an unforgettable experience where performance meets precision.
